Characteristics of the development of athletic form in highly qualified long jumpers (based on the example of Olympic Champion D. Phillips)
Abstract and keywords
Abstract (English):
The purpose of the study is to identify the characteristics of the development (formation) of an athlete's sports form across various macrocycles over a ten-year period. Research methods and organization. The study was conducted at the educational and research laboratory of the Department of Theory and Methodology of Athletics named after N. G. Ozolin at the RUS «GTSOLIFK». The analysis of scientific and methodological literature, the analysis of documentary materials, logical-theoretical research methods, and methods of mathematical statistics, specifically descriptive statistics methods, have been utilized. Research results and conclusions. The issues of structure, phasing, and criteria for determining athletic form in highly qualified athletes have been examined. The features of development (formation) and dynamics of the athletic form of Olympic Champion D. Phillips have been identified over the macrocycles during the ten-year period of his sporting career (2002-2011).
